2016-06-15 6 views
0

Я использую VLCKit в быстры, поэтому я создал вид подгоняет видеоплеер и у меня есть внешние субтитры для фильмов из ссылок, я читать файлы с сервера и преобразовать его таким образом строкаVLCKit субтитров не показывая

do { 
     let text = try NSString(contentsOfURL: NSURL(string: self.subtitleUrl)!, encoding: NSUTF8StringEncoding) 

     self.mediaPlayer.openVideoSubTitlesFromFile(text as String) 

    }catch { 
     print("Error") 
    } 

и я называется функцией с именем «openVideoSubTitlesFromFile» в плеер, но не работает кто может дать мне решение

ответ

0

Этот метод (который будет устаревшим в следующей основной версии VLCKit) не только принимать локальные пути к файлам, ни удаленных URL-адресов. Вам необходимо загрузить файл субтитров, кешировать его локально и предоставить путь к сохраненному файлу методу. Кроме того, вы можете использовать этот метод только после начала воспроизведения.

Смежные вопросы